#200cc8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#200cc8 is composed of 12.5% red, 4.7%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84% cyan, 94%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 246.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 41.6%. #200cc8 color hex could be obtained by blending #4018ff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#200cc8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02010f is the darkest color, while #fcf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#200cc8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#67666e is the less saturated color, while #1a04d0 is the most saturated one.
